 Management – EA - Party, Offer and Financial data is also known as
Master Data and executed as a master record structured in ERP.
◦ Most companies classified the master data as highly restricted and limited who
could see the information.
 Cost or pricing leaking to the competitors
 Customer, Suppliers or Employee list leaking to the competitors
 Management to transaction - a point in time transaction – EA – MVSM
records related to the retention schedule for zero data loss SA/TA
◦ A distinction between Master and Transactional data which captures a point in
time and will include any exceptions, which do not translate into a new rule for
pricing purposes.
 Many companies are failing at the segregation of duties as they believe the key
control only relates to the Segregation between IT and Business.
 Most companies also fail by thinking Key controls are just a report.
 The transaction will be processed and ideally the validation from finance will be
performed, at this time capturing the record for audit purposes minimizes the offline
attempts which fail by threading the transaction across both parts of the income
statement.
